How to Configure PPPoE Settings on a Monitoring Device83


PPPoE (Point-to-Point Protocol over Ethernet) is a networking protocol that allows devices to establish a direct connection over an Ethernet network. It is commonly used by Internet service providers (ISPs) to provide broadband internet access to residential and business customers.

In order to use PPPoE on a monitoring device, you will need to configure the device's PPPoE settings. These settings typically include the following:
PPPoE username
PPPoE password
PPPoE service name
PPPoE MTU (Maximum Transmission Unit)

The PPPoE username and password are provided by your ISP. The PPPoE service name is typically the name of your ISP's network. The PPPoE MTU is a technical setting that is typically set to 1492.

Once you have gathered all of the necessary information, you can configure the PPPoE settings on your monitoring device. The steps for doing this will vary depending on the make and model of your device. However, the general steps are as follows:1. Log in to the monitoring device's web interface.
2. Navigate to the PPPoE settings page.
3. Enter the PPPoE username, password, service name, and MTU.
4. Click the "Save" button.

Once you have configured the PPPoE settings, your monitoring device will be able to establish a connection to your ISP's network. You will then be able to access the internet and use the monitoring device to monitor your network.

Troubleshooting PPPoE Connection Issues

If you are having trouble connecting to your ISP's network using PPPoE, there are a few things you can try:
Verify that the PPPoE username and password are correct.
Verify that the PPPoE service name is correct.
Verify that the PPPoE MTU is set to 1492.
Restart the monitoring device.
Contact your ISP for support.
